Just fab - when you say you scrub and moisturise - do you mean you moisturise before you put the fake tan on?

if so that could be your problem....always scrub but don't moisturise for 24 hours before tanning....or it won't soak in...sort of slides about a bit instead IYKWIM ??

Pinot · 25/05/2012 20:22

Are you using a fake tan mitt? You need one of those. They are idiot proof That and a decent tanner. here

I have green to hazel eyes and always wear a fine line of chocolate shimmer gel eyeliner by Bobbi Brown. Costs about £20 but will last 3/4 years. Then I overline softly with either a purple liner, blended gently in. Or a green eyeliner - same again, softly blended. Just the hint of colour brings out the colour of my eyes whilst the brown gel liner does the job of framing my eyes and making my lashes look longer.

Don't forget to curl your eyelashes too.
